CBI May Question BSNL After the raid on DoT by Central Bureau of Investigation over the grant of 2G licenses to new operators on a first come first serve basis without competitive bidding, now the bureau may question BSNL management on their entering into a roaming agrement with Etisalat DB India (previously called Swan Telecom). The agreement had surged Swan's value to $2 billion at the time of offloading its stake to Etisalat. (Read more at Telecom Tiger) Control News Access - Google Newspaper publishers can now prevent unrestricted access to their subscription websites . Users who view free news via Google may be routed to payment or registration pages if they click on more than five news articles in a day. (Read more at MobiGyaan) Tata Teleservices Adds More Subscribers Anil Sardana, MD, Tata Teleservices, has said that November subscriber additions are close to October's addition of 3.88 million. Tata Docomo and Tata Indicom are the GSM and CDMA brand of Tata Teleservices.
